Abstract
The utility model discloses a kind of dismounting of GCB circuit breaker operation mechanisms and travelling bogies, it includes bottom support frame, the two sides of the bottom support frame are fixed with lateral frame, the both ends of the lateral frame are equipped with jacking screw rod by screw-driven cooperation, the bottom of the jacking screw rod is equipped with lower margin idler wheel, it is supported by arc fagging on the bottom support frame, limiting device is provided between the arc fagging and bottom support frame.When solving the dismounting maintenance of GCB circuit breaker operation mechanisms, cause operating mechanism dismounting inconvenient since operating mechanism is overweight, volume is excessive, the problem of operating personnel faces larger personal safety risk.

Background technology
GCB, i.e. generator outlet circuit breaker system, including breaker, isolation switch, grounding switch and its linear quadratic control portion
It being grouped as, is suitable for the various large power plants such as nuclear power, thermoelectricity and water power, breaker uses SF6 medium arc extinguishings, technology maturation,
Dependable performance.
SF6 breakers are using SF6 gases as the breaker of dielectric.Since SF6 gases have excellent insulation and go out
Arc performance makes in SF6 breaker high-tension circuits using more and more.In addition, as China Power cause rapidly develops, development is super
High voltage power transmission is the direction of China electric utility development, thus large size SF6 breakers applied in current electric power enterprise it is more next
It is more.Understand SF6 breaker structures and technical characterstic, grasp the operation of SF6 breakers and maintenance technology, to ensureing that power grid security can
By operation, electrical equipment installation, operation and maintenance quality are improved, electric power system fault probability is reduced and is of great significance.
But SF6 breakers need to overhaul it after used a period of time, in maintenance process, need to use
Private carrier transports it.

Specific implementation mode
The embodiment of the utility model is described further below in conjunction with the accompanying drawings.
As shown in Figs. 1-2, a kind of GCB circuit breaker operation mechanisms dismounting and travelling bogie, it includes bottom support frame 1,
The two sides of the bottom support frame 1 are fixed with lateral frame 5, and the both ends of the lateral frame 5 are coordinated by screw-driven
Jacking screw rod 4 is installed, the bottom of the jacking screw rod 4 is equipped with lower margin idler wheel 3, is supported by the bottom support frame 1
Arc fagging 10 is provided with limiting device between the arc fagging 10 and bottom support frame 1.It is small by above-mentioned transport
Vehicle easily can be dismounted and be transported to GCB breakers, and then improve the safety of its dismounting.
Further, reinforcing plate 2 is welded between the bottom support frame 1 and lateral frame 5.By described
Reinforcing plate 2 increases its structural strength.
Further, the top installation settings of the jacking screw rod 4 has hex nut 6.Pass through 6 energy of hex nut
It is enough that easily jacking screw rod 4 is rotated, and then make it through screw-driven cooperation and entire bottom support frame 1 is driven to carry out
Jacking.
Further, the limiting device includes positioning stud 8, and the positioning stud 8 is fixed by the first locknut 9
On bottom support frame 1, by two limited support nuts 7 and setting in 10 both sides of arc fagging on the positioning stud 8
Limiting plate 11 match, be machined with limiting slot 12 on the limiting plate 11, the limiting slot 12 passes through positioning stud 8.Pass through
The limiting device can be supported and limit to arc fagging 10.
The tooling is realized by the way that breaker dismounting arc fagging to be placed on travelling bogie to GCB circuit breaker operation mechanisms
The function of dismounting and transport.Specific implementation step is as follows:
The first step, assembled carriage:10 concave surface of arc fagging is placed on upward on bottom support frame 1, it is small by transporting
The positioning stud 8 of vehicle passes through the limiting slot 12 on arc fagging 10 to fix arc fagging 10, and adjustment jacks screw rod 4 by bottom branch
Support frame frame 1 is adjusted to proper height.
Second step removes stoppage circuit breaker:Assembled tooling in step 1 is sent into GCB circuit breaker operation mechanisms lower part,
Arc fagging 10 is lifted by adjustment jacking screw rod 4 to be contacted with GCB circuit breaker operation mechanisms.Dismantle GCB circuit breaker operation mechanisms peace
Fill bolt, so that GCB circuit breaker operation mechanisms is detached with GCB ontologies, by travelling bogie by GCB circuit breaker operation mechanisms transport to
Designated position.
Third walks, and installs circuit breaker operation mechanism:GCB circuit breaker operation mechanisms are hung in the assembled tooling of step 1
On, and GCB circuit breaker operation mechanisms are pushed into installation site, GCB circuit breaker operation mechanisms are raised to conjunction by adjustment jacking screw rod 4
Suitable height, and by 8 rotary operation mechanism of positioning stud, operating mechanism Installation posture is finely tuned, GCB circuit breaker operation mechanisms are installed
Fixing bolt makes GCB circuit breaker operation mechanisms be fixed with GCB ontologies.
